Various heads including 7th Baron King of Ockham, 1st Earl Granville, 5th Earl de la Warr and 1st Earl Amherst of Arracan

by Sir George Hayter
circa 1820
5 1/2 in. x 8 1/2 in. (139 mm x 214 mm)
NPG 2662(20)

Inscriptionback to top

Annotated at left: Mr Cowan 9.10 Saturday/Brougham/Denman/Dr Lushington/Wilde/Tyndal/Williams/Vizard//S.J. Copley/Sr R. Gyfford/Park/Sr Chris Robinson/Dr Adam/Powell/Maule, and at right identifying four heads: Ld King/Granville/De Lawarr/Amherst, and by the dispatch box: on the Table.

This portraitback to top

As with NPG 1695(a-x), the drawings [NPG 2662(1-38)] were made in the House of Lords during the trial of the Queen.

Physical descriptionback to top

Seven heads and open dispatch box.

Provenanceback to top

Uncertain until collected by Arnett Hibbert and bought from his daughter-in-law, Violetta Hibbert, 1934 (for £5).
